Large-Cap & Core Holdings Report
Kakao — Target price cut, AI monetization takes time
Daol Securities has lowered Kakao’s target price from 70,000 KRW to 60,000 KRW, citing delays in AI monetization. Concerns are also rising regarding potential strike risks stemming from conflicts over performance bonuses.
Kakao has transferred its Daum portal service to AXZ, valuing it at approximately 140 billion KRW in intangible assets, and is observing a roughly 10% stake acquisition through a new share swap with Upstage.
HYBE — Ranked #1 in Entertainment Brand Reputation
HYBE solidified its top spot in the June 2026 entertainment stock brand reputation rankings with a 14% increase. JYP saw a sharp 52% decline, falling to 3rd place.

Daehan Shipbuilding — Signs 282.8 billion KRW supply contract with Oceania
Daehan Shipbuilding signed a 282.8 billion KRW contract to supply two crude oil carriers (157,000 DWT) to an Oceanian shipowner (23.03% of recent annual revenue).
Market Macro Environment — Intensifying foreign sell-off
On the 4th, KOSPI retreated to the 8,600 level as foreign investors net sold nearly 7 trillion KRW worth of stock over 19 consecutive trading days. The surge in exchange rates is further dampening market sentiment.
Bio & Tech Growth Stock Analysis
Vaxcell-Bio — Clinical expectations rise
Vaxcell-Bio (immune cell therapy) is showing stock price gains fueled by clinical expectations.
Seegene — Confirms Q1 profitability recovery
Seegene confirmed a rebound in profitability in the first quarter, the first since the COVID-19 pandemic. Operating profit margins rose to the 18% range, indicating both top-line growth and margin recovery, with particularly positive signals from the non-respiratory sector.

ADC Market Expansion — Heated competition for next-gen anticancer drugs
The status of the Antibody-Drug Conjugate (ADC) market is rising rapidly. Including new drugs from MSD, it is emerging as a key player in next-generation cancer treatment, quickly expanding its influence in the global market.
IT/Gaming/Content Sector Strategy
Krafton — Full-scale multi-platform expansion
Krafton is expanding its business from being a gaming-centric company into a comprehensive digital content powerhouse covering advertising, content, AI, and robotics. Advertising accounted for over 20% of total revenue in Q1.

Krafton’s "Real Cricket" recorded strong growth alongside India’s IPL 2026 season, hitting all-time high monthly downloads and revenue figures since launch.
Kakao Games — Acquisition process by Line Yahoo ongoing
The acquisition process of Kakao Games by a Special Purpose Company (SPC) invested in by Line Yahoo is underway, with a new board of directors expected to be appointed at an extraordinary shareholders' meeting later this month.
Studio Dragon — Leading the H1 drama market
Studio Dragon continues to dominate the drama market, having released successful titles in the first half of this year such as "Undercover Miss Hong," "Yumi's Cells 3," and "The Cook."
Industrial & Energy Sector Strategy
Hanwha Solutions — Expectations for solar and ESS expansion
Hanwha Solutions’ Q-Cells division is receiving positive evaluations for its strategy to expand its solar and ESS businesses in the United States. Strengthening an integrated energy business model that covers not just solar module supply but also ESS, centered on North America, has been a key driver for its stock price.
